marcus is going through a particularly difficult time because of work - related stress, his parents health problems, impending final exams, and term paper deadlines. marcus has a history of not dealing well with stress. the continuous stress is likely to cause all these except:
cause marcus to develop cancer.
cause the blister on marcus foot to heal more slowly than normal.
weaken marcus resistance to a bad cold.
alter marcus immune system so that he does not fight off disease as well.
Stress can weaken the immune system, leading to slower wound healing (like a blister), reduced resistance to common illnesses (such as a cold), and altered immune function. However, while chronic stress may have an impact on overall health, it is not a direct cause of cancer. Cancer development is a complex process involving genetic, environmental, and lifestyle factors, not just stress alone.
